Just simply the 710 is only there to add ports, not designed for gaming. 7 is the gen number and 10 is the tier in that gen. It goes on from there to 20/30, 50, 60, 70 then 80. ie GTX750/750Ti would whoop the 9600GT but PSU might be an issue running 750Ti, or at least find one not requiring a 6pin pcie plug. 9600GT is slightly better than the 710 im afraid.
Could go a GT 1030 if you couldn't find a second hand 750/750Ti. Careful buying cards from used market, plenty of fakes out there, usually originating from China.
